Accusing opportunists of exploiting Netaji's popularity to peddle bogus tales about his "disappearance" in 1945 and his "non-existent afterlife post-1945," Netaji Subhas Chandra Bose's grandnephew and noted historian Sugata Bose said this has pained many in the Bose family immensely.

"There is no doubt that he was killed in air crash," Bose, Gardiner Chair at Harvard University and former MP, told PTI.
